**Company Overview**
Teledyne Qioptiq designs and manufactures market leading optronic solutions for Aerospace & Defence applications. Key applications include Head-Up Display & Helmet Mounted Display modules for 4th & 5th generation fast jet platforms, vision solutions for the Dismounted Soldier, and advanced Electro-Optics for Airborne, Maritime and Vehicle Platforms. Qioptiq has a world-renowned reputation for technical innovative solutions combined with the highest standards of product quality, customer service and business integrity.
